Wimbledon: Queen Elizabeth II Arrives, Dines

Queen Elizabeth II is at the All-England Lawn Tennis and Croquet Club for the first time in 33 years.

After going through a receiving line of tennis greats that included Serena Williams, Novak Djokovic and Roger Federer, the Queen ate lunch with another group of tennis' elites that included British greats Tim Henman and Virginia Wade.  The group ate salmon, chicken, and some traditionally Wimbledonish strawberries.

The Queen is now seated  in the front row of The Royal Box at Centre Court watching Andy Murray vs. Jarkko Nieminen, quite visible in a bright robin's egg blue ensemble.

It has been announced that she will stay until 4 PM, when she will depart for tea time.
